Cillian Murphy is intriguing in the role of Patrick 'Kitten' Braden, he felt really authentic to me - there's a certain artifice to the act of being yourself, I think, for transvestites, and he gets that down.

The film's sort of a mess in terms of plotting and editing, which seems to be more the fault of the book-to-screen adaptation than the performances or camera work. It's hard to tell sometimes where you are and how you got there.

It's a very interesting and engaging story, though, and there are some very powerful scenes. I saw it as more of a story of resilience than anything else.

This review of Breakfast on Pluto (2005) was written by on 06 Jan 2008.
